Typography has been a driving force behind the success of many companies and individuals. In his famous commencement speech at Stanford University in 2005, Steve Jobs, co-founder of Apple Inc., attributed his life-changing moment to a typography class he took in college. He expressed how his fascination with the beauty of type and typography eventually influenced the design and aesthetic of Apple products. It is remarkable to think that a seemingly unrelated field like typography can have such a profound impact on technology and innovation.
On the other hand, humanoids, which are robots designed in the form of humans, have also significantly shaped our world. The term "humanoid" originated in 1867 and refers to something that resembles the shape of a human. These robots typically have a head, two arms, and two legs, with a symmetrical body structure and the ability to walk upright. The first humanoid robot, Wabot-1, was developed by Japanese engineer Ichiro Kato in 1973. It was not until 1996 that Honda introduced the world's first humanoid robot capable of bipedal walking.
The development of humanoid robots has been driven by various factors, one of which is the Fukushima nuclear disaster. The need to access areas that are inherently inaccessible to humans led to the development of robots that could prevent the spread of disasters. Since 2011, research in this field has rapidly progressed, particularly in the context of disaster response and mitigation. Furthermore, many aspects of modern civilization are tailored to the human body, making humanoid robots a natural fit for various applications.
The military sector has also recognized the potential of humanoid robots. The Defense Advanced Research Projects Agency (DARPA) in the United States considers the use of human-controlled humanoid robots as the ultimate application in military piloting. However, recent events have accelerated research in the field of disaster response. The Fukushima nuclear disaster prompted DARPA to organize the Robotics Challenge, which has spurred significant advancements in humanoid robot capabilities. The usefulness of humanoids in disaster scenarios, such as fires, earthquakes, and collapses, cannot be overstated. These situations require the prevention of further disasters and the minimization of damage, which can be facilitated by humanoid robots.
The Fukushima incident highlighted the limitations of human intervention in highly hazardous environments. Experts believed that if someone could enter the nuclear power plant and close valves and other equipment, a second explosion could have been prevented. Unfortunately, the high levels of radiation made it impossible for humans to enter, and no existing robot was capable of navigating the debris and climbing ladders. This prompted DARPA, under the Department of Defense, to organize the Robotics Challenge to encourage innovation and the development of robots that can operate effectively in such environments.
